What is the Citroen C8 MOT pass rate by year?

The MOT pass and failure rate for each Citroen C8 model year, from the DVSA record. Only years with at least 1,000 tests are shown, so each figure is a real average rather than a handful of cars. The Citroen C8 averages 33.0% failures across all years.

YearPass rateFailure rateTests
200367.1%32.9%35,217
200467.1%32.9%40,479
200567.7%32.3%30,521
200667.5%32.5%24,461
200765.3%34.7%18,239
200865.5%34.5%9,195
200967.6%32.4%4,638
201068.9%31.1%1,070

Does age change how often a Citroen C8 fails?

Older Citroen C8s fail more often, as expected. The 2003 cars fail 32.9% of tests against 31.1% for the 2010. Across every year the model averages 33.0%. The 2007 is the weakest year at 34.7%, and the 2010 the strongest at 31.1%.
